Alonso takes a swipe at negative media

Fernando Alonso isn't denying McLaren's lackluster form, but the Spaniard believes the media's negative spin on events of late has led to an exaggeration of its state of affairs. There was no place to hide for McLaren last week in France, after reports of a staff revolt and 'toxic' working atmosphere at Woking were followed by the team's dismal performance out on the race track at Paul Ricard. However, Alonso took aim at the media on Thursday in Austria, insisting McLaren plight was no where as bad as reported.
